Becca Kendis, Esq., MSSA is a lecturer and staff attorney at the Case Western Reserve University School of Law, affiliated with the Center for Reproductive Law and the Reproductive Rights Law Initiative (RRLI). She provides legal support to reproductive healthcare providers, conducts legislative analysis, and engages in advocacy and education.
- Education:
- Juris Doctor (JD), Case Western Reserve University
- Master of Social Science Administration (MSSA), Case Western Reserve University
- Bachelor of Arts in Social Change and Activism, University of Michigan
Her work focuses on reproductive rights, human trafficking, and interdisciplinary legal advocacy, emphasizing collaboration between law, social work, and healthcare. She currently litigates challenges to Ohio’s abortion restrictions in federal and state courts.
Her publications analyze judicial approaches to reproductive rights and legal frameworks addressing human trafficking. Though no scientific awards are listed, her career spans roles at the ACLU of Ohio, Milestones Autism Resources, and NARAL Pro-Choice Ohio.
Becca contributes to legal education through courses like the Reproductive Rights Lab and Human Trafficking Clinic Seminar, reflecting her commitment to training future advocates.
